/*
* This is the unit tests file for common/loader.c
*/
#include <global.h>
#include <stdlib.h>
#include <check.h>
#include <loader.h>
#include <toolkit_common.h>
#include <object.h>
#include <stringbuffer.h>
void setup(void) {
cctk_setdatadir(BUILD_ROOT "lib");
cctk_setlog(LOGDIR "/unit/common/loader.out");
cctk_init_std_archetypes();
}
void teardown(void) {
/* put any cleanup steps here, they will be run after each testcase */
}
START_TEST(test_get_ob_diff) {
StringBuffer *buf;
object *orc;
archetype *arch;
char *result;
arch = find_archetype("orc");
fail_unless(arch != NULL, "Can't find 'orc' archetype!");
orc = arch_to_object(arch);
fail_unless(orc != NULL, "Couldn't create first orc!");
buf = stringbuffer_new();
get_ob_diff(buf, orc, &arch->clone);
result = stringbuffer_finish(buf);
fail_unless(result && result[0] == '\0', "diff obj/clone was %s!", result);
free(result);
orc->speed = 0.5;
orc->speed_left = arch->clone.speed_left;
FREE_AND_COPY(orc->name, "Orc chief");
buf = stringbuffer_new();
get_ob_diff(buf, orc, &arch->clone);
result = stringbuffer_finish(buf);
fail_unless(result && strcmp(result, "name Orc chief\nspeed 0.500000\n") == 0, "diff modified obj/clone was %s!", result);
free(result);
orc->stats.hp = 50;
orc->stats.Wis = 59;
orc->expmul = 8.5;
orc->stats.dam = 168;
buf = stringbuffer_new();
get_ob_diff(buf, orc, &arch->clone);
result = stringbuffer_finish(buf);
fail_unless(result && strcmp(result, "name Orc chief\nWis 59\nhp 50\nexpmul 8.500000\ndam 168\nspeed 0.500000\n") == 0, "2n diff modified obj/clone was %s!", result);
free(result);
}
END_TEST
START_TEST(test_dump_object) {
/** we only test specific things like env/more/head/..., the rest is in test_get_ob_diff(). */
StringBuffer *buf;
object *empty;
char *result;
char expect[10000];
/* Basic */
empty = arch_to_object(empty_archetype);
fail_unless(empty != NULL, "Couldn't create empty archetype!");
snprintf(expect, sizeof(expect), "arch empty_archetype\nend\n");
buf = stringbuffer_new();
dump_object(empty, buf);
result = stringbuffer_finish(buf);
fail_unless(result && strcmp(result, expect) == 0, "dump_object was \"%s\" instead of \"%s\"!", result, expect);
free(result);
/* With more things */
empty->head = arch_to_object(empty_archetype);
empty->inv = arch_to_object(empty_archetype);
empty->more = arch_to_object(empty_archetype);
empty->owner = arch_to_object(empty_archetype);
empty->env = arch_to_object(empty_archetype);
fail_unless(empty->head != NULL, "Couldn't create empty archetype as head!");
fail_unless(empty->inv != NULL, "Couldn't create empty archetype as inv!");
fail_unless(empty->more != NULL, "Couldn't create empty archetype as more!");
fail_unless(empty->owner != NULL, "Couldn't create empty archetype as owner!");
fail_unless(empty->env != NULL, "Couldn't create empty archetype as env!");
snprintf(expect, sizeof(expect), "arch empty_archetype\nmore %d\nhead %d\nenv %d\ninv %d\nowner %d\nend\n", empty->more->count, empty->head->count, empty->env->count, empty->inv->count, empty->owner->count);
buf = stringbuffer_new();
dump_object(empty, buf);
result = stringbuffer_finish(buf);
fail_unless(result && strcmp(result, expect) == 0, "dump_object was \"%s\" instead of \"%s\"!", result, expect);
free(result);
}
END_TEST
Suite *loader_suite(void) {
Suite *s = suite_create("loader");
TCase *tc_core = tcase_create("Core");
/*setup and teardown will be called before each test in testcase 'tc_core' */
tcase_add_checked_fixture(tc_core, setup, teardown);
suite_add_tcase(s, tc_core);
tcase_add_test(tc_core, test_get_ob_diff);
tcase_add_test(tc_core, test_dump_object);
return s;
}
int main(void) {
int nf;
Suite *s = loader_suite();
SRunner *sr = srunner_create(s);
srunner_set_xml(sr, LOGDIR "/unit/common/loader.xml");
srunner_set_log(sr, LOGDIR "/unit/common/loader.out");
srunner_run_all(sr, CK_ENV); /*verbosity from env variable*/
nf = srunner_ntests_failed(sr);
srunner_free(sr);
return (nf == 0) ? EXIT_SUCCESS : EXIT_FAILURE;
}
